Keys stolen or lost car keys replacement cost
Up until recently, losing your car key wasn't a big deal. If you don't have a spare, you can purchase one from the hardware store or locksmith. With the development of modern vehicles keys for cars are now more complicated and difficult to duplicate. Depending on your car's model and year, you may have to visit the dealership or a specialist locksmith for your vehicle to obtain an entirely new key.
Before even thinking about going to a hardware store or auto locksmith, record your car's identification number (VIN). The 17-digit code can be located on the dashboard of the driver's car as well as on the windshield frame, and sometimes in other places, such as the front of the engine, on the trunk lid and so on. Your VIN can be located on your insurance documents. The VIN will allow you to locate the most suitable person to replace your key according to the type of key you have.
Traditional keys are the most simple to replace and you can go to an auto locksmith and have the new one made right on the spot. Typically, the cost is $20 or less. If you own an electronic key, switchblade key, or transponder key, it's best to contact your dealership. The dealership will be able to inform you of the price a new key will cost because they have all the data from the original key.

Key Fobs
Many vehicles sold today come with key fobs that permit drivers to lock or start their car by pressing a button. The metal part of the car key still has to be turned in the ignition however, the fob makes this process simpler and safer than before. Fobs can be extremely durable but they don't last for a long time. They can be expensive to replace if they stop working.
If your key fob isn't functioning, the first thing to do is replace the battery. These are usually very inexpensive, and you can often locate them at big-box stores or hardware stores. You might need to do some research, but you will be able to locate the right battery for your car by checking YouTube videos of people who have replaced their fob battery.
You can access the fob and see whether it is experiencing any other problems. Key fobs are tossed around often and, over time, they can sometimes break down or be out of adjustment. Open the fob and look for the seam. Use a flat-head screwdriver, which is used to gently break the fob.
